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While in Rameshwaram, don't miss the opportunity to visit the Kothandaramaswamy Temple, situated in Dhanushkodi. This ancient temple boasts beautiful carvings and offers a serene atmosphere. Another hidden gem is the Gandhamadhana Parvatham, known for its panoramic views and tranquil surroundings. For a unique experience, take a small boat ride to the Kurusadai Island, where you can spot migratory birds and enjoy the unspoiled beaches. These off the beaten path attractions are perfect for families seeking peaceful and immersive experiences amidst nature.
